About Leon L. Robert
Leon L. Robert is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Insect Science, Plant Science, Epidemiology and Molecular Biology, having authored 23 papers that have together received 375 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Research on Leishmaniasis Studies (8 papers), Insect Pest Control Strategies (5 papers), Trypanosoma species research and implications (4 papers), Mosquito-borne diseases and control (4 papers), Insect and Pesticide Research (3 papers), Insect Resistance and Genetics (3 papers), Insect Utilization and Effects (2 papers) and Malaria Research and Control (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Insect Science (127 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(263 citations), Parasitology (26 citations), Plant Science (145 citations) and Infectious Diseases (41 citations). Leon L. Robert has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Kenya and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Robert A. Wirtz, Michael J. Perich, Robert A. Wirtz, Russell E. Coleman, Richard N. Johnson, Najibullah Safi, C. O. Anjili, Gary D. Davis, Robert A. Copeland and Todd W. Walker.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Medical Entomology, Acta Tropica, Veterinary Research Communications, ChemPlusChem and Journal of the American Mosquito Control Association.
